Definitions
- the present invention relates to a device for immobilizing at least one wheel of a wheelchair installed in a vehicle with a floor, the device comprising means for blocking the front and rear of said wheel, said locking means comprising two articulated flaps intended for frame, when in the raised position and forming a Vee, said wheel.
- the present invention provides a simpler device and allowing free movement when the device is not in use.
- the subject of the invention is therefore a device for immobilizing at least one wheel of a wheelchair installed in a vehicle with a floor, the device comprising means for blocking the front and rear of said wheel, said locking means comprising two articulated flaps intended for frame, when in the raised position and forming a V, said wheel, characterized in that the two flaps are operated by a jack arranged vertically, and connected to each of the two flaps by transmission means comprising a part joint linked to the end of the rod of said jack, said common part comprising, on the one hand, guide means along a guide slide parallel to the jack, during the maneuvers of raising and lowering the flaps, and on the other hand a means cooperating with a holding means fixed in part bottom of the device for locking the flaps in the raised position for use, and in that the two articulated flaps are integrated in the thickness said vehicle floor in their out-of-service position, the upper face of the flaps then flush with said floor.
- An advantage of the immobilizer wheelchair of the invention is that the passenger is autonomous in the passenger car.
- Another advantage of the immobilizer of a wheelchair of the invention is that the means of controls are easily maneuverable.
- Another advantage of the immobilizer of a wheelchair of the invention is that the the invention does not hinder free movement in the passenger car when not in use.
- Another advantage of the immobilizer of a wheelchair of the invention is that the device can be operated under the most severe conditions, know: emergency braking, transverse acceleration and longitudinal.
- Another advantage of the immobilizer of a wheelchair of the invention is that the device is monobloc added, hence easier assembly.
- Another advantage of the immobilizer of a wheelchair of the invention is that the device integrates easily into the environment.
- FIGS 1 and 2 are perspective views of the wheelchair immobilizer according to the invention.
- the wheelchair immobilizer of the invention is capable of being installed in a floor, for example a floor of a passenger car of a rail or road vehicle or a floor from an airplane or a boat.
- the wheelchair immobilizer of the invention is also adapted to function as escalator, for example in a private home or in a public or private building.
- the wheelchair immobilizer of the invention consists of mechanical means integrated in the thickness of the floor and control means of these mechanical means also integrated and accessible to the person using the wheelchair.
- the integrated mechanical means of the device immobilization of a wheelchair of the invention is consist of two articulated flaps 2 arranged in a box 1, the assembly being integrated into the thickness of the vehicle floor 3.
- the two articulated flaps 2 each have a wall 2A movable in rotation relative to the base of the flap articulated concerned.
- the two articulated flaps 2 have the function to immobilize the main R wheels of the wheelchair of the causes the movable walls 2A of the two hinged flaps 2 are positioned, respectively, on both sides of the main wheels of the wheelchair, the walls mobile then forming a Vé.
- the two articulated shutters are flush with the floor while in the position of use (see Figure 2), the two hinged shutters form an obstacle above the floor sufficient to prevent movement of the wheelchair during maximum acceleration, especially when braking emergency.
- control means of the mechanical means integrated include two push buttons 8, 9 arranged, preferably on the upper part of a cover 10 of so as to be accessible to the person using the Wheelchair.
- Control means for integrated mechanical means are for example mechanical, electrical means, pneumatic or hydraulic.
- Locking means 11 control means integrated mechanical means may be used to to order the order of the integrated mechanical means when no wheelchair is placed between the two articulated shutters.
- Authorization to commission the device immobilization of a wheelchair is for example performed using the train officer's service key.
- FIG. 3 represents a front view of a mode of preferred embodiment of the shutter control means articulated.
- the hinged flaps 2 are operated by a actuator by means of transmission of the force produced by the actuator.
- the actuator consists, for example, of a cylinder 4.
- the means of transmission are, for example, rods 5 and levers 13 each linked to a shutter 2.
- the cylinder 4 is for example a pneumatic cylinder.
- the jack 4 is arranged vertically relative to the floor 3 of the vehicle.
- the articulated flaps 2 are arranged on either side of the jack 4 and are, each, connected to one end of the jack via the lever 13, articulated at one end of the link 5, and of a common part 6 to which is articulated the other end of each link 5.
- the common part 6, linked to the end of the rod of the jack 4 locks the hinged flaps in the use position (flaps 2 raised, horizontal rods 5) by penetration of a 6D projection of the part common 6 in a well 6E of a holding means 6A of cylindrical shape arranged coaxially with the jack 4 and fixed in the lower part of the box 1.
- This locking of the flaps 2, in their position of use, by the penetration of the projection 6D of the common part 6 into the well 6E of the holding means 6A has the function of taking up the forces exerted by the rods 5 during a force applied to one or other of the flaps 2 in this raised position of use, particularly when moving the vehicle.
- this common part 6 comprises a lug 6C which slides in a section guide guide 7 transverse U-shaped arranged parallel to the cylinder 4, until, in limit switch, the projection 6D of the part 6 comes into the well 6E of the holding means 6A.

Claims (1)
- Dispositif pour immobiliser au moins une roue (R) d'un fauteuil roulant installé dans un véhicule comportant un plancher (3), le dispositif comprenant des moyens de blocage de l'avant et de l'arrière de ladite roue, lesdits moyens de blocage comprenant deux volets articulés (2) destinés à encadrer, lorsqu'ils sont en position relevée et formant un Vé, ladite roue, caractérisée en ce que les deux volets (2) sont manoeuvrés par un vérin (4) disposé verticalement et relié à chacun des deux volets (2) par des moyens de transmission (6, 5, 13) comportant une pièce commune (6) liée à l'extrémité de la tige dudit vérin (4), ladite pièce commune comportant d'une part des moyens de guidage (6C) le long d'une glissière de guidage (7) parallèle au vérin, pendant les manoeuvres de montée et de descente des volets (2), et d'autre part un moyen (6D) coopérant avec un moyen de maintien (6A) fixé en partie basse du dispositif pour le verrouillage des volets en position relevée d'utilisation, et en ce que les deux volets articulés sont intégrés dans l'épaisseur dudit plancher (3) du véhicule dans leur position hors service, la face supérieure des volets affleurant alors ledit plancher (3).
